Sun columnist and CTS TV host Michael Coren doesn’t like something in former MP Garth Turner’s new book: Sheeple: Caucus Confidential in Stephen Harper’s Ottawa.
One particular issue Coren takes issue with was beaten to death at the time and was recently resurrected by Coren as fodder for two columns.
On May 2nd Coren wrote his Sun column; Bleat the clock on Sheeple, GarthTurner and Charles McVety, with a practised eye on the guest calendar of his TV show.
Since the original comment by Charles McVety to Garth Turner was supposedly made on the set or the general vicinity of The Michael Coren show made it into Sheeple; Coren used his May 2nd column to again say he and his staff heard no such thing. However Garth Turner didn’t show up to tape the show and Michael Coren is miffed. Coren has published 10 books, been on TV over 10 years, does radio, he knows all the drills. He does conservative social outrage for a living, miffed is easy.
Coren devoted his next column to Turner being his first TV guest ever to be a no-show and how traumatizing and rude it all was to Coren’s TV staff. Being a media pro, he ratcheted up his rhetoric.
I have to say, however, that with former MP Garth Turner I’m not particularly surprised. Turner has been on my show several times over the years, sometimes requesting the opportunity, and now that he has a book out, Sheeple, we were willing to give him a full hour of interview.
